The Role of Blockchain in Making Payment Systems More Accessible
Blockchain technology is revolutionizing the way payment systems operate, making them more accessible to individuals and businesses around the world. By utilizing decentralized networks, blockchain enhances transparency, security, and efficiency in financial transactions, thereby breaking down barriers that previously hindered access to traditional payment systems.
One of the key advantages of blockchain is its ability to facilitate peer-to-peer transactions without the need for intermediaries such as banks. This reduces costs and speeds up transaction times, making it particularly beneficial for those in underserved or remote areas where traditional banking services may be limited. With blockchain, users can send and receive payments almost instantly, regardless of their geographical location.
Moreover, blockchain technology enhances security through cryptographic encryption. Each transaction is stored in a block and linked to the previous one, creating a secure chain of data that is nearly impossible to alter. This high level of security builds trust among users, encouraging more people to participate in the digital economy. As a result, individuals and small businesses that may have previously hesitated to adopt digital payments can now do so with confidence.
In addition, blockchain enables microtransactions, allowing users to conduct smaller transactions that may have been economically unfeasible with traditional payment systems. For instance, artists can sell digital content directly to consumers for minimal fees, democratizing access to creative revenues. This functionality empowers users in developing economies, enabling them to partake in the global marketplace.
Furthermore, blockchain's transparency eliminates fraud and corruption in payment systems. Every transaction is recorded on a public ledger, allowing participants to verify the authenticity of transactions. This transparency is particularly beneficial in regions where trust in financial institutions is low, encouraging wider participation in digital payments and broader financial inclusion.
The integration of blockchain-based payment systems also paves the way for innovative financial products. Smart contracts, which are self-executing contracts with the terms of the agreement directly written into code, can automate processes such as payments and escrow services. This reduces reliance on intermediaries and further lowers costs, enhancing accessibility for all users.
